About Solana Name Service (previously Bonfida) (FIDA) in Korea
Solana Name Service (SNS), formerly known as Bonfida (FIDA), is a groundbreaking platform that enhances the usability of blockchain technology by simplifying the way users interact with decentralized applications. Within the burgeoning South Korean crypto landscape, SNS stands out for its ability to transform complex wallet addresses into user-friendly domain names. This innovation not only streamlines transactions but also fosters greater adoption of cryptocurrency among everyday users. The South Korean market has shown a growing interest in decentralized finance (DeFi) and non-fungible tokens (NFTs), making the need for intuitive solutions more pressing. By providing a seamless naming service, SNS enables users to send and receive crypto with ease, reducing the risk of errors associated with traditional wallet addresses. Its integration with popular dApps and platforms further enhances its acceptance, as users seek reliable and efficient tools for their digital transactions. The compliance of purchasing Solana Name Service (previously Bonfida) (FIDA) in Korea
**Compliance Description for Purchasing Solana Name Service (FIDA) in Korea** **Regulatory Framework** - **Financial Services Commission (FSC)**: The FSC oversees the regulation of financial markets in South Korea, including cryptocurrencies. Users should be aware that certain digital assets may be classified under existing financial regulations, which could impact their purchase and trading activities. - **Korean Financial Intelligence Unit (KoFIU)**: KoFIU mandates compliance with anti-money laundering (AML) and counter-terrorism financing (CTF) regulations. Cryptocurrency exchanges operating in Korea must implement robust KYC (Know Your Customer) procedures to verify user identities and monitor transactions. - **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) of Korea**: Similar to other jurisdictions, the SEC may classify certain digital assets as securities. Users should be informed about these classifications, as they could influence the legality and structure of their investments in FIDA. **Compliance Considerations for Users** - **Tax Obligations**: Cryptocurrency transactions, including those involving FIDA, are subject to taxation under Korean law. Users must be aware of potential capital gains tax implications and are encouraged to maintain meticulous records of their transactions for reporting purposes. - **KYC and AML Compliance**: Users must complete KYC procedures when engaging with exchanges. This may include providing personal identification documents and proof of address. Compliance with AML regulations is essential to prevent illegal activities and ensure a secure trading environment. - **Consumer Protection Laws**: South Korea has established laws to protect consumers in financial transactions. Users should be aware of their rights and the responsibilities of exchanges to ensure a compliant trading experience. **Best Practices for Users** - **Choose Reputable Exchanges**: It is advisable to utilize exchanges that are registered and compliant with Korean regulations. This ensures that transactions are secure and that the platform adheres to necessary KYC and AML standards. - **Stay Informed on Regulations**: Users should regularly update themselves on changes in the regulatory landscape regarding cryptocurrencies in Korea. Being informed about new laws or amendments can help users navigate the market effectively. - **Maintain Accurate Records**: Keeping detailed records of all transactions, including dates, amounts, and involved parties, is essential for tax compliance and potential audits by regulatory authorities. **Conclusion** When purchasing Solana Name Service (FIDA) in Korea, understanding the compliance landscape is vital for a smooth and legal transaction process. By familiarizing themselves with relevant regulations and following best practices, users can confidently engage in the digital asset market while minimizing legal risks. Staying informed and ensuring compliance not only protects users but also contributes to a more secure and trustworthy cryptocurrency environment in Korea.
